30 years ago with lot of community support His Branches, Inc., a nonsectarian 501(c)3
faith-based organization, opened
on Arnett Boulevard in the heart of the City of Rochester, NY, as part of a progressive vision, dream, and prayer. The vision was of people from all walks of life being helped by gifted Christian doctors and nurses working with others who were living out their faith caring for those in need. The dream included people living in communities where children could grow up in healthy families, play in safe neighborhoods, worship in vibrant churches, and learn in enriching schools. Since those early days, the vision has remained intact while the structure has undergone significant revision. Medical services, which were once offered under the independent sponsorship of The Chapel Guidance Center, Inc., have been brought
under the corporate sponsorship of His Branches and identified to the community as Grace Family
Medicine Associates (GFM), the name under which a Physician, Nurse Practitioner, and Physician
Assistant currently operate in private practice. His Branches contracts with
the providers to provide faith-based primary care to an underserved
population and, in turn, provides space and administrative services for
which the providers are billed accordingly. Patients are billed directly
in each provider's name in a manner ranging from private pay on a
sliding fee scale up through all the major insurance carriers, including
Medicaid and Medicare.
A primary goal of our associated providers (one of the
few groups in Rochester that offers medical care on a sliding fee scale) is to
make their services accessible and affordable for anyone who comes through our door.
Beyond the
three full-time practitioners, the staff is comprised of 5 full-time equivalent administrative staff and one full-time nurse.
These staff are all hired by His Branches and provided to the clinicians
for their medical service in the context of their private practices.
Funding for the current arrangement is almost entirely borne by the
providers through receipts from their patient encounters. Each health
professional is independently licensed and is responsible for
maintaining their credentials and quality of care. From the beginning,
this “sheltered private practice” arrangement has been working in NY
by legally allowing the uncompromised and openly faith-based practice of
medicine, supported by spiritually compatible staff.

As the founder of this ministry, Dr. William Morehouse has maintained and promoted a progressive vision for healthy and whole communities. His faithful service has been felt throughout the City of Rochester and beyond. There are few places you can go in Rochester that do not know about Dr. Morehouse. While many doctors have come and gone during his tenure, Dr. Morehouse and his family have lived in the same neighborhood as His Branches for nearly 30 years. He has been recognized for numerous achievements, including being honored
in 2002 with the "Leo Holmsten Human Life Award" for his pro-life work in the
community and in 2005 with the "Health Care Achievement Award" by the
Rochester Business Journal. He has also served for years as the Faculty Advisor for the
Christian medical students at the University of
Rochester and was instrumental in starting and maintaining an active parallel to the Christian Medical and Dental Association
(CMDA) in the Rochester area called the
Greater Rochester Medical Center Christian Fellowship (GRMCCF).
